Perfect Chemistry- Simone Elkeles




A fresh, urban twist on the classic tale of star-crossed lovers.

When Brittany Ellis walks into chemistry class on the first day of senior year, she has no clue that her carefully created “perfect” life is about to unravel before her eyes. She’s forced to be lab partners with Alex Fuentes, a gang member from the other side of town, and he is about to threaten everything she's worked so hard for—her flawless reputation, her relationship with her boyfriend, and the secret that her home life is anything but perfect. Alex is a bad boy and he knows it. So when he makes a bet with his friends to lure Brittany into his life, he thinks nothing of it. But soon Alex realizes Brittany is a real person with real problems, and suddenly the bet he made in arrogance turns into something much more.

In a passionate story about looking beneath the surface, Simone Elkeles breaks through the stereotypes and barriers that threaten to keep Brittany and Alex apart. -http://www.amazon.ca/Perfect-Chemistry-Simone-Elkeles/dp/0802798225


I discovered this book in a monthly e-mail I get from Nelson Agency. This was under what they were reading and I googled the book to see what kind of novel the agent liked, and found an expect to read. After reading it I begged my mom to drive me to the book store. Later that week I was coming out of the book store a proud owner of Perfect Chemistry. I didn't even wait to get home before I started reading.I sat in the backseat and never looked up again until we were back at the house, I then barricaded myself in my room and continued to read.

This book abducted me and I had no desire to be released. When I finished the last page I had to get the next book, Rules of Attraction (review to be done later).Its like Romeo and Juliet, but with a happy ending, I tell people. This was an amazing read and I recommend it whenever I hear somebody is looking for a new and amazing fresh book to read.

Having said that, over all I give this book from 1, I couldn't finish it to 10, unputdownable, I rank this book a 10, I loved every page of this book!
